Transaction 10064f1396eecedf1d6f1f56e8cc1608192feb8d6dcd3bfe4d41287d6a1730bd
1 Input
1 Output
-
10064f1396eecedf1d6f1f56e8cc1608192feb8d6dcd3bfe4d41287d6a1730bd:0
- value
- 5466554
- script pubkey
- OP_0 OP_PUSHBYTES_20 85b0593bcd58d4cfd0934dbad412ad5b571cca29
- address
- bc1qskc9jw7dtr2vl5ynfkadgy4dtdt3ej3fnxny26